    Wear Failure Analysis of Small Crown-head Double-thread Bolts of A286 Steel

    • A small crown-head bolt and a double floating plate nut seized each other after 4 times of disassembly, and it was found that the bolt had worn seriously after disassembly. In this paper, macro and micro morphology observation, chemical composition analysis, mechanical properties test, metallographic structure observation, and comparative test verification were carried out to analyze the main reason for the bolt wear failure. The results show that if the convergent nut has a smaller closing, the friction force between the bolt and nut threads will increase abnormally, resulting in rapid wear. The material properties of the bolt and nut are similar. Thus adhesion occurred between the bolt and nut during friction match, and then wear occurred.
